Transaction 5bba95d207bd19798d31ce24cabab1c6802b4ff155b95d3ee25121b33581ef3f
1 Input
1 Output
-
5bba95d207bd19798d31ce24cabab1c6802b4ff155b95d3ee25121b33581ef3f:0
- value
- 51450622
- script pubkey
- OP_0 OP_PUSHBYTES_32 f6a8d409c594a34faee7f746629c5899e564b63bf7c507f9c24e943661272e8a
- address
- bc1q765dgzw9jj35lth87arx98zcn8jkfd3m7lzs07wzf62rvcf8969qdspkzt